Immigrants from Zimbabwe vs Palestinian Poverty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 117,789,316 people shows a weak positive corre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from Zimbabwe and poverty level in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.270 and weighted average of 11.6%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 216,388,270 people shows no correlation between the proportion of Palestinians and poverty level in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.036 and weighted average of 11.6%, a difference of 0.090%.
